Hair Loss as a Medical Condition

Hair Loss Clinic at Haneul Dermatology Clinic Busan Seomyeon

Hair loss — whether androgenetic alopecia (AGA), alopecia areata, telogen effluvium, or traction alopecia — is a medical condition requiring diagnosis before treatment. At Haneul Dermatology, the board-certified dermatologist assesses hair loss type, degree, and contributing factors (hormonal, nutritional, stress-related, autoimmune) before designing a care programme. This diagnostic-first approach is the standard in dermatology — it is not universal in the hair care market.

Hair loss treatment at Haneul is not supplement-based or generic programme-based. KFDA-approved medical treatments — including topical and systemic medications where clinically indicated — are combined with device-based scalp and hair follicle treatments in an individualised programme.

Hair Loss Assessment

The dermatologist uses clinical assessment and scalp examination to classify hair loss type, determine the stage (Hamilton-Norwood for men, Ludwig for women), and identify potential contributing factors. Blood tests for nutritional deficiencies, hormonal levels, and thyroid function may be recommended. This foundation is essential before any treatment programme is initiated — treating androgenetic alopecia with the same approach as alopecia areata produces poor results.

Hair Care Programme

The Hair Care Programme at Haneul typically combines KFDA-approved topical and/or oral medical treatment (where clinically appropriate), scalp care management for sebum, inflammation, or sensitivity, and device-based follicle stimulation treatments. Scalp LED, micro-needling (MTS), and mesotherapy-style scalp injections are available where clinically indicated. The programme design and frequency are adjusted based on hair loss type and response at review appointments.

FAQ

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ions from patients visiting or living in Busan — including international patients.

Can hair loss be reversed?
Response depends on hair loss type and stage. Androgenetic alopecia can be arrested and partially reversed in early-to-mid stages with appropriate medical treatment. Alopecia areata has high spontaneous recovery rates in limited disease. The dermatologist provides an honest assessment of realistic prognosis at consultation.
How is Haneul's hair loss programme different from a hair clinic?
Haneul Dermatology approaches hair loss as a medical condition requiring diagnosis by a board-certified dermatologist. The treatment includes prescription medication where appropriate — not only cosmetic device treatments or supplements.
Is hair loss treatment available for international visitors?
Yes. International patients can begin assessment and initial treatment during their visit. Medical prescriptions can be provided for continuation at home where appropriate. Written English treatment summary provided.
How long before I see results from hair loss treatment?
Medical treatment for AGA typically shows measurable improvement at 3–6 months with continued response over 12 months. Device treatments produce progressive improvement over a similar timeline. Telogen effluvium (shedding from stress or illness) often resolves partially once the trigger is addressed.
